Before he was Forrest Gump...Before he became America’s Dad...Tom Hanks almost killed his career in the 1980’s with a string of mediocre, low-box-office comedies where he basically played the same role repeatedly - the charming, lovable, unthreatening, wisecracking everyman. Apart from making a big splash with enormous hits like Big and Splash, there is little to distinguish most of his movies made in the Me Decade. Which got us to thinking: How did the 80’s not manage to sink Tom Hanks entirely? Because about 93% of his filmography from this era is pretty awful, if we’re being honest. Don’t get us wrong, there are a few underappreciated gems in the lot, to be sure, and we’ll mostly be touching on those. Join us for a look back at a time before he was a superstar and T.
